Choosing the Right Model: 3 Crucial Factors
- Temperature tolerance range (-30°C to +45°C recommended)
- Scalability options for future expansion
- Local certification requirements (CE, IEC 62619)

FAQ: Outdoor Energy Storage Cabinets
- Q: How long do batteries last in freezing conditions? A: Properly heated cabinets maintain 80% capacity after 3,000 cycles at -20°C.
- Q: Can existing solar systems integrate these cabinets? A: Yes – most models accept DC inputs from 300V to 1,500V.
